definition of responsible

The word responsable It is widely used in our daily conversations, although, it does not always refer to the same thing since it presents several references.

One of the most frequent uses is given at the request of wanting to refer when a person is the cause of a certain situation. It is worth noting that the situation that triggers it is always bad, negative and therefore it is framed as an unpleasant and despicable action. Thus, whoever murders an individual or commits any other offense will be indicated as the responsible for a crime, theft, etc.

On the other hand, the word responsible is also used to designate that person who by the circumstances is obliged to answer and act for something or for another person who may be in his charge or under his responsibility. Likewise, this obligation of answering by someone occurs a lot in social matters, especially, in those who have the responsibility of directing and managing groups. A department head of a company will be responsible for the effectiveness of the employees in his area.

He too individual who is responsible for the management of an activity or work is designated as responsible. In this way, when someone takes care of the administration and direction of a home that houses orphaned children, they will be considered responsible for it. To make donations at home, you should speak with the person in charge, he will tell you how to proceed.

In another circumstance in which we use the word is when we want to realize that someone is committed to their obligations and their satisfactory fulfillment and also shows great care and meticulousness in everything they do. Laura is so responsible that no one ever doubts her reports. You are not responsible at all in the study, you have taken no more and no less than three subjects this year.
